Assessment and Inspection

Our team arrives and checks the damage. We look for standing water, discoloration, and any signs of mold. We document everything so you know exactly what’s going on. We use moisture meters to measure the depth of the damage. This helps us plan the best way to fix it. You get a clear picture of the situation before we start.

Water Extraction

We use powerful extractors to remove standing water. This step is critical because the longer water sits, the more damage it causes. We work quickly to get the water out and prevent it from soaking into the subfloor. We use high-powered fans and dehumidifiers to dry the area. This helps stop mold growth and keeps your floors safe.

Sanitization and Disinfection

After the water is gone, we clean the area to remove any bacteria or mold spores. This step is important for your health and the longevity of your floors. We use eco-friendly products that are safe for your home. We make sure every corner is clean and ready for the next step. No hidden dangers left behind.

Drying and Dehumidification

We use industrial-grade equipment to dry the floor and surrounding areas. This process can take 3-5 days, depending on the severity. We monitor the moisture levels daily to make sure everything is drying properly. We don’t rush this step because it’s essential for preventing future damage. You can count on us to do it right.

Restoration and Refinishing

Once everything is dry, we start the restoration process. We sand and refinish the floor to bring it back to its original look. We match the color and texture so it blends in with the rest of your home. We make sure the floor is smooth and ready to use. You get a floor that looks great and lasts for years.

Warning Signs You Need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air

Early signs of water damage can be easy to miss. But if you catch them early, you can save your floors and avoid costly repairs. Don’t ignore these warnings. They’re your first clue that something is wrong. The longer you wait, the more damage you’ll face.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A damp, musty smell is a sign of hidden moisture. It can mean water is trapped underneath the floor. This is a red flag. You don’t want mold to grow in your home. Get help before the odor becomes a bigger problem. Don’t ignore this warning.

Swelling or Warping in the Floor

If your floor is cupping, buckling, or lifting, that’s a sign of water damage. The wood is absorbing moisture and changing shape. This can lead to permanent damage. Don’t wait for it to get worse. Call a professional before the floor is beyond repair.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Dark spots or water stains on your floor are a clear sign of moisture. These can show water has soaked into the wood. The longer it stays, the more damage it causes. You need to address this quickly. Don’t let the problem grow.

Feeling Wet or Warm in Certain Areas

If some parts of your floor feel wet or warm to the touch, that’s a sign of trapped moisture. It can mean water is sitting under the floor. This is dangerous and can lead to mold and structural issues. Don’t ignore this. Get help before it’s too late.

Peeling or Bubbling Finish

A damaged finish on your hardwood floor can be a sign of water damage. The moisture can cause the varnish to lift or bubble. This is a serious issue that needs attention. Don’t let it get worse. You need to act fast to prevent more damage.

Mold Growth in the Grout or Baseboards

Mold in the grout or along the baseboards can mean water is seeping into the floor. This is a health hazard and a sign of deeper damage. You need to get this fixed before it spreads. Don’t risk your family’s health. Call a professional today.

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air Cost In Andover, MA

Hardwood floor water damage repair costs vary based on the size of the area, the type of damage, and the time it takes to fix. You can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for basic repairs. But the cost can go higher if the damage is severe or if there’s mold involved. These are just estimates, and the exact price depends on the situ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$200 – $800 Amount of water, time to extract, and location of damage.
Drying and dehumidification $500 – $1,500 Size of area, moisture levels, and drying time needed.
Sanitization and mold removal $300 – $1,200 Extent of mold, type of surfaces, and cleaning methods.
Repair and refinishing $600 – $2,000 Condition of the floor, type of wood, and finish needed.
Odor removal and air purification $200 – $800 Severity of smell, type of contaminants, and space size.
Inspection and assessment $150 – $400 Time and expertise required to evaluate the damage.

How can I prevent water damage on my hardwood floors?

Keep an eye on leaks, fix plumbing issues quickly, and use a dehumidifier in damp areas. You can also place mats in high-traffic areas to catch water. Regular maintenance helps prevent damage.
